The Canisius Crusaders will head out on the road to take on the Nichols Vikings at 4:45 p.m. on Wednesday. The last three games Canisius has played have been within two runs, so don't be surprised if it's a close one.
Last Monday, Canisius sure made it a nail-biter, but they managed to escape with a 5-4 win over Nichols.
Jack Steiner looked comfortable as he tossed 3.2 innings while giving up no earned runs off five hits.
At the plate, the team relied heavily on David Cloyd, who went 1-for-3 with three RBI, a triple, and a run. Another player making a difference was Aaron Jones, who went 2-for-3 with two RBI.
Canisius now has a winning record of 8-7. As for Nichols, they are on a seven-game losing streak that has dropped them down to 5-10.
